# .htaccess 를 통한 http -> https 리다이렉트 방법

#### <span style="color: rgb(230, 126, 35);">**.htaccess 를 통한 http -&gt; https 리다이렉트 방법**</span>  


<span style="color: #1d1c1d; font-family: 나눔고딕, NanumGothic, sans-serif;">**※ 주의사항  
  
<span style="color: rgb(186, 55, 42);">반드시 SSL 보안인증서가 설치된 상태에서 작업해 주셔야합니다.</span>**</span>

<span style="color: #1d1c1d; font-family: 나눔고딕, NanumGothic, sans-serif;">  
</span>

SSL 보안인증서 설치 완료 후에 http 주소로 접속하신다면 SSL 보안인증서가 적용되지 않은 것으로 보이게 됩니다.

<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">하여 http 주소로 접속하여도 https 주소로 접속이 되었으면 하실 경우 리다이렉트 작업을 진행해 주셔야합니다.</span>

<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">  
</span>

<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">먼저, 리다이렉트 작업을 진행하시기 전 반드시 https 주소로 접속이 원활한지 확인 후 진행해 주셔야합니다.</span>

<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">https://도메인 으로 접속하시어 아래 이미지와 같이 주소창에 자물쇠 모양이 확인되는지 확인해 주세요.</span>

<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">  
</span>

<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">[![htaccess_01.jpg](https://docs.dothome.co.kr/uploads/images/gallery/2025-09/scaled-1680-/htaccess-01.jpg)](https://docs.dothome.co.kr/uploads/images/gallery/2025-09/htaccess-01.jpg)</span>

<span style="color: rgb(22, 145, 121);">\[웹호스팅 SSL 보안 인증서 적용 확인 화면\]</span>

<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">https 주소 적용 여부가 확인 되셨다면 아래의 순서대로 .htaccess 파일을 수정하여 리다이렉트 설정 확인을 해주세요.</span>

**<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">1. FTP로 접속하여 html 폴더 안에 .htaccess 파일이 있는지 확인 후 </span>.htaccess​ 파일을 다운로드를 받아주세요.**

<span style="color: #6ba54a; font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">- 만약 .htaccess 파일이 보이지 않는다면 FTP 프로그램에서 \[서버\] - \[숨김 파일 강제 표시\]를 설정해 주세요.</span>

<span style="color: #6ba54a; font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">- 그래도 확인되지 않는다면 메모장에 작업 후 파일명을 .htaccess 으로 지정하여 저장해 주세요.</span>

<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">  
</span>

<span style="color: #000000; font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">[![htaccess_02.jpg](https://docs.dothome.co.kr/uploads/images/gallery/2025-09/scaled-1680-/htaccess-02.jpg)](https://docs.dothome.co.kr/uploads/images/gallery/2025-09/htaccess-02.jpg)</span>

<span style="color: rgb(22, 145, 121); font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">\[웹호스팅 .htaccess 파일 다운로드 화면\]</span>

<span style="color: #000000; font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">  
</span>

**<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">2. 메모장과 같은 프로그램을 통해 .htaccess 파일을 PC에서 열고 아래 코드를 붙여넣고 저장해주세요.</span>**

<span style="font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">- 구문 내 URL은 이용 중이신 호스팅 계정명에 맞게 수정하여 입력해 주셔야 합니다.</span>

```bash
<IfModule mod_rewrite.c>

RewriteEngine On 

RewriteCond %{HTTPS} off 

RewriteCond %{SERVER_NAME} !=계정명.dothome.co.kr [NC] 

RewriteCond %{REQUEST_URI} !^/.well-known 

Rewriterule (.*) https://%{http_host}%{request_uri} [L,R=301]

</IfModule>
```

​

**3. FTP로 접속하여 html 폴더 안에 .htaccess 파일을 덮어씌워주세요.**

[![htaccess_03.jpg](https://docs.dothome.co.kr/uploads/images/gallery/2025-09/scaled-1680-/htaccess-03.jpg)](https://docs.dothome.co.kr/uploads/images/gallery/2025-09/htaccess-03.jpg)

<span style="color: rgb(22, 145, 121); font-family: 나눔고딕코딩, NanumGothicCoding, sans-serif;">\[웹호스팅 .htaccess 파일 덮어쓰기 화면\]</span>

**4. 브라우저의 캐시 데이터를 삭제 후 http 주소로 접속했을 때 https 주소로 변경되며 접속되는지 확인해 주세요.**